4. Average Fee

  • An average fee for the sale or purchase of a £300,000 property using a specialist residential lawyer in the Home Move Team based on an hourly rate of £180 per hour:
  • For a freehold sale: 5-8 hours up to and including completion
  • For a freehold purchase: 6-9 hours up to and including registration of your purchase with the Land Registry
  • For a leasehold sale: 6-9 hours
  • For a leasehold purchase: 7-10 hours up to and including registration of your purchase with the Land Registry
  • This fee does not include:
    • VAT
    • Bank Transfer fees and Online Stamp Duty Land Tax Return fees
    • online ID & Lawyer checks
    • Local Search fees, Drainage Search fees and Environmental Search Fees on average £250
    • land registry fees which in this example will be £270.00 and other registration costs such as the costs of registering a transfer of a lease with the landlord
    • Stamp Duty Land Tax: a calculator for which can be found at www.tax.service.gov.uk/calculate-stamp-duty-land-tax/#/intro
    • Where the title to the property is unregistered or there are other complications such as boundary issues
    • Management Company Fees
    • Mortgage Handling Fee
